TurbiTech LS Sensor
Designed to monitor the levels of suspended solids or turbidity typically found in final effluent from municipal and industrial wastewater treatment plants. It is also capable of monitoring solids intake for both effluent and drinking water treatment processes. The normal operating range is between 0 - 50 and 0 - 500 FTU, which can be extended to 0-1,000 FTU for specific applications.
TurbiTech LA & HR Sensors
Designed for use in aeration systems. The TurbiTechw² HR sensor is suitable for monitoring solids at higher ranges than the standard LA version of the sensor due to its shorter path length.
- The TurbiTech LA Sensor has been designed for use in aeration systems, typically monitoring Mixed Liquor Suspended Solids (MLSS), also known as Activated Sludge, where solids are typically in the range of 1,500 to 3,500 mg/l. The sensor can also measure Returned Activated Sludge (R.A.S.), Surplus Activated Sludge (S.A.S.), and Suspended Solids or Turbidity in any higher-range application.
- The TurbiTech HR Sensor has been specifically designed for use in wastewater treatment systems where high levels of suspended solids are desirable in the aeration phase. Membrane batch reactors typically operate with MLSS values in the range of 8,000 to 14,000 mg/L.
